Dec 25, 2010. Well it's Saturday morning, and this little tropical vacation is winding down. We leave today around 1:45pm. As promised, here's a little post about the rest of my training during this trip. Wednesday I fell in love with a new trainer workout. 10min. warm-up, then 1-2-3-4-5-4-3-2-1 climbing reps with equal rest between. It made the hour fly by! Thursday was an off day! Friday I woke up and had some serious stomach issues. I thought I wasn't going to be able to run at all! And that was it.

Dec 20, 2010. First off, please excuse any poor grammar or misspellings in this post! Im typing from a keyboard synched to Spanish! But I have been able to train every day so far. On the first day I got up at 6am (3am Oregon time! And was on the treadmill by 7am. I ran 35 minutes, then did a strangth session. Im glad the gym here has a stocked gym, because Ive been meaning to incorporate strength into my training for awhile now.and the limited training options here make this the perfect time!
